Output 0c39b74526677f4cc8166c64881d38e34dfd0fa81ec602e952aa98d438cbda9e:3

value
37000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e90683701dbf2bbbfa54e4e75bf95ae412fbec07 OP_EQUAL
address
3Nw9AoRgeWaupS52MC6tWb47Rdykcb8bU1
transaction
0c39b74526677f4cc8166c64881d38e34dfd0fa81ec602e952aa98d438cbda9e
confirmations
318285
spent
true